For Ghana traders, trading costs are a critical factor, and Pepperstone generally offers lower spreads than AvaTrade. Pepperstone's Razor account provides spreads from 0.0 pips on major pairs like EUR/USD, with a commission of $3.50 per lot per side, making it cost-effective for high-volume traders. AvaTrade's standard account has spreads from 0.9 pips with no commission, which is better for smaller traders but more expensive for larger volumes. For example, a Ghana trader executing 100 lots per month on EUR/USD would pay approximately $700 in commissions with Pepperstone versus $900 in spread costs with AvaTrade. Both brokers offer competitive pricing, but Pepperstone's raw spreads and low commissions make it the cheaper option for active Ghana traders.

Both brokers provide robust trading platforms tailored to Ghana traders' needs. Pepperstone offers MetaTrader 4 (MT4), MetaTrader 5 (MT5), cTrader, and TradingView, all optimized for fast execution and advanced charting. AvaTrade provides MT4, MT5, AvaTradeGO (mobile app), and WebTrader, with additional features like automated trading through DupliTrade and ZuluTrade. For Ghana traders who prefer algorithmic trading or social trading, AvaTrade's ecosystem is more comprehensive. However, Pepperstone's cTrader is superior for scalping and day trading due to its depth of market and low latency. Both platforms support Ghana's local internet speeds and mobile usage.

Regulation is crucial for Ghana traders to ensure fund safety and fair trading. Pepperstone is regulated by top-tier authorities including the FCA (UK), ASIC (Australia), and CySEC (Cyprus), providing strong investor protection and negative balance protection. AvaTrade is regulated by the Central Bank of Ireland, ASIC, and the FSCA (South Africa), among others. For Ghana traders, both brokers comply with international standards, but the local financial regulator requires brokers to be licensed. Pepperstone and AvaTrade are not directly regulated by the Ghana Securities and Exchange Commission but are allowed to accept Ghana clients as long as they adhere to local laws. Ghana traders should verify that their chosen broker has adequate compensation schemes, such as the FSCS for Pepperstone (up to Β£85,000) or the ICF for AvaTrade (up to €20,000).

Both Pepperstone and AvaTrade offer Islamic (swap-free) accounts for Ghana Muslim traders who need to comply with Sharia law, which prohibits interest (riba). Pepperstone provides Islamic accounts on request, with no swap charges on overnight positions for major forex pairs, indices, and commodities. AvaTrade automatically offers Islamic accounts for eligible clients, with the same swap-free conditions. Ghana traders should note that Islamic accounts may have limited instrument availabilityβ€”for example, Pepperstone excludes cryptocurrencies from swap-free status. Both brokers require proof of Islamic faith or a declaration of religious belief. These accounts are ideal for long-term position traders in Ghana who want to avoid interest costs while trading.
